SD museum with rare instruments seeks $15M revamp
2013/02/17 21:51:31 @Entertainment News Headlines - Yahoo! News
VERMILLION, S.D. (AP) — Grammy-winning fingerpicking guitarist Pat Donohue thinks a South Dakota college town of about 10,000 is an unlikely place for a wide-ranging collection of musical instruments that includes saxophones built by inventor Adolphe Sax, a rare Stradivarius violin with its original neck and a Spanish guitar on which Bob Dylan composed some of his earliest songs.
